Please Wait

Please Wait

Welcome To DWT Listing Theme

1 Results found

not found

The Joint Chiropractic

Welcome to The Joint Chiropractic - Charlottesville! As your Charlotte...

The Joint Chiropractic
The Joint Chiropractic
February 28, 2025
not found